New Deal Policies

  • Emergency Banking Relief Act

    Emergency Banking Relief Act
    The purpose of the Emergency Banking relief Act was to authorize the federal government to control the banking systems and rescue previously failing banks. This was a relief for the people and it was part of the first New Deal.
  • Agricultural Adjustment Act

    Agricultural Adjustment Act
    It was designed to boost agricultural prices by reducing surpluses. The government bought livestock for slaughter and paid farmers not to plant on their part of land. This was a Recovery and it had taken place during the first New Deal.
  • Home Owner´s Refinancing ACT

    Home Owner´s Refinancing ACT
    It was created to provide mortgage assistance to homeowners by providing them money or refinancing mortgages. This act was a recovery and it was part of the first new deal.
  • National Industrial Recovery Act

    National Industrial Recovery Act
    It was a United States labor law that was passed by the congress to authorize the President to regulate industry. Overall this would help the economy. This act is a recovery and its part of the first new deal policy.

  • National Housing Act

    National Housing Act
    the National Housing Act was part of the New Deal in order to make housing and home mortgages more affordable.This was a reform and it had taken place during the first new deal.
  • Works Progress Administration

    Works Progress Administration
    The works progress Administration was an American New Deal agency, employing millions of people to carry out public works projects, including the construction of public buildings and roads. This was a Reform and it had taken place during the second new deal.
  • Wagner Act

    Wagner Act
    he Wagner Act guarantees basic rights of private sector employees to organize into trade unions. This act was a recovery and took place during the second new deal.
  • Social Security Act

    Social Security Act
    The Social Security Act created a basic right to a pension in old age, and insurance against unemployment. This act was a reform that took place during the second new deal.
  • Soil Conservation Act

    Soil Conservation Act
    The Soil Conservation Act allowed the government to pay farmers to reduce production to help prevent soil erosion. This act was a reform that took place during the second new deal.
  • Fair Labor Standard Act

    Fair Labor Standard Act
    The Fair Labor Standards Act created a minimum wage, overtime pay, and prohibits ”oppressive child labor”. This act was a recovery and it had taken place during the second new deal.
  • Resettlement Administration

    Resettlement Administration
    A New Deal U.S. federal agency that relocated struggling urban and rural families to communities planned by the federal government. This was a Relief and it had took place during the second new deal.
